The European market\u2019s requirements for building materials\u2019 environmental standards continue to tighten.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.sumecbuildingmaterial.com\/fr\/\">Rubber\u00a0wood<\/a>\u2019s sustainable supply model of &#8220;one tree, dual purposes&#8221;\u2014harvested after the latex production cycle without the need to cut down primary forests specifically\u2014fully aligns with the circular economy concept. Its processing scraps can be recycled, further reducing environmental burden. Marble-veined panels, on the other hand, tend to use man-made board substrates made from recycled raw materials, paired with low-VOC coatings. Their formaldehyde emissions strictly meet the EU E1 standard or even higher, and some products have passed rigorous certifications such as the German Blue Angel. This combination of dual environmentally friendly materials not only meets the mandatory requirements of EU Construction Products Regulation but also caters to consumers\u2019 demands for green homes, becoming a core competitiveness for entering the European market.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The technological upgrading and style evolution of marble-veined panels themselves have also injected more possibilities into their matching with <a href=\"https:\/\/www.sumecbuildingmaterial.com\/fr\/\">rubber\u00a0wood<\/a>. In residential spaces, cabinets and bathroom vanities with <a href=\"https:\/\/www.sumecbuildingmaterial.com\/fr\/\">rubber\u00a0wood<\/a> bodies and marble-veined countertops have become popular choices. Rubber\u00a0wood\u2019s moisture resistance and durability perfectly match the high-frequency use scenarios of kitchens and bathrooms, while marble-veined panels\u2019 easy-to-clean feature adds practical value. In commercial spaces, rubber\u00a0wood\u00a0tables and chairs paired with marble-veined walls in restaurants, and rubber\u00a0wood decorative lines paired with marble-veined floors in hotels, not only enhance the space\u2019s elegance but also meet the needs of wear resistance and easy maintenance. In addition, the growing demand for the restoration and renovation of historical buildings in Europe has led this material combination to be used in the partial transformation of heritage buildings. The natural texture of rubber\u00a0wood and the classic charm of marble veins can complement the style of old buildings while meeting the functional requirements of modern use.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>As the European home furnishings market\u2019s demand for texture and environmental protection continues to deepen, the matching trend of <a href=\"https:\/\/www.sumecbuildingmaterial.com\/fr\/\">rubber\u00a0wood<\/a>\u00a0and marble-veined panels will be further consolidated.
